Click​ here for previous session            God’s Name and the Royal Plural You see things; and you say “Why?” But I dream things that never were; and I say “Why not?”—George Bernard Shaw, Back to Methuselah No discussion of God’s name is complete without explaining the royal plural. This is a linguistic concept foreign to most native English speakers, but not to the English language. As recently as the seventeenth century, the word thou was applied to commoners while the word you, the Old English plural of...
